Advanced Search
Advanced Search functions are available for detailed search operations. They allow
searches on metadata displayed in the grid columns.
The Grid Filter bar can be displayed just over the Elements grid by clicking the Search
button above the grid:
To hide the Grid Filter bar, click the Search button once again.

Element Grid
Introduction
The Elements grid represents the content of the tree branch selected in the Tree view. .
It also returns the result of a search applied to a selected branch of the Tree view.
In the grid, elements are presented in rows and all their associated parameters and
metadata are in columns.
Elements Grid Header Contextual Menu
Right-clicking the grid header displays the grid contextual menu.
The options are described in the following table:
Option
Description
Hide
Hides the selected column.
Organize
The Select Columns window opens and allows the selection of
columns to display and in which order.
Save grid
organization
Saves the organization of the grid as it is displayed (columns selection,
order and size). It is saved by each user. Therefore, this organization
will be retained the next time the user logs in and opens the application.
Reset grid
organization
Returns the grid to the default grid organization.
Sorting the Elements in the Grid
At start of the application, items are sorted with most recent on top.
